The overview below groups typical Warehouse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Brecksville,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or warehouse remodeling tasks, such as shelving adjustments or door repairs,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.
Partial Remodels - when upgrading specific areas like office spaces or loading zones,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$5,000.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, but most fall within the moderate budget.
Major Renovations - extensive warehouse overhauls, including structural modifications or new flooring, typically cost $10,000-$50,000. These projects are less common and usually involve detailed planning and higher expenses.
Full Warehouse Replacement - complete rebuilds or significant structural overhauls can range from $100,000 to over $500,000, depending on size and scope. Such large-scale projects are less frequent and represent the upper tier of remodeling costs in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
